Histórico da Página
Ato processual automático ao tombar publicações
Características do Requisito
Linha de Produto: | Microsiga Protheus | ||||
Segmento: | Jurídico | ||||
Módulo: | SIGAJURI | ||||
Rotina: |
| ||||
País(es): | Todos | ||||
Banco(s) de Dados: | Todos | ||||
Tabelas Utilizadas: | O0O - Ato processual Automático O0P - Palavras Chave Ato Processual | ||||
Sistema(s) Operacional(is): | Windows |
Descrição
Inclusão de cadastro de Ato processual automático com palavras chaves, sendo assim, utilizado ao tombar publicações.
O Ato processual será é informado automaticamente se a palavra chave cadastrada bater corresponder TOTALMENTE com o texto encontrado na publicação publicação .
Procedimento para Implantação
O sistema é atualizado logo após a aplicação do pacote de atualizações deste chamado.
- Aplique o patch do chamado e execute uma vez a rotina UPDDISTR.
Logo após a execução desta rotina é alterado o dicionário de dados da base é atualizado, conforme especificações abaixo:
Atualizações do Compatibilizador
- Criação de tabela no arquivo SX2– Tabelas:
Chave | Nome | Modo | PYME |
O0O | Ato processual Automático | C | S |
Chave | Nome | Modo | PYME |
O0P | Palavras Chave Ato Processual | C | S |
2. Criação de Campos no arquivo SX3 – Campos:
- Tabela O0O - Ato processual Automático
Campo | O0O_FILIAL | ||
Tipo | C | ||
Tamanho | 8 | ||
Decimal | 0 | ||
Formato | @! | ||
Título | Filial | ||
Descrição | Filial do Sistema | ||
Usado | Não | ||
Obrigatório | Não | ||
Browse | Não | Relação | Val. Sistema |
Help | Filial do Sistema |
Campo | O0O_COD |
Tipo | C - Caracter |
Tamanho | 5 |
Decimal | 0 |
Formato | @! |
Título | Código |
Descrição | Código Ato Processual Aut |
Nível | 1 |
Usado | Sim |
Obrigatório | Sim |
Browse | Não |
Validação | EXISTCHAV('O0O',O0O_COD,1) |
Inicializador Padrão | GETSXENUM("O0O","O0O_COD") |
Visual | Visualizar |
Contexto | Real |
Modal | Sim |
Help | Código Ato Processual Automatico |
Campo | O0O_CODATO | |
Tipo | C - Caracter | |
Tamanho | 3 | |
Decimal | 0 | Formato|
Título | Ato | |
Descrição | Codigo do Ato Processual | |
Nível | 1 | |
Usado | Sim | |
Obrigatório | sim | |
Browse | Não | |
Validação | (ExistCpo('NRO',M->O0O_CODATO,1) .AND. JURVLDREST('NRO',M->O0O_CODATO)).OR. VAZIO() | |
Inicializador Padrão | Visual | Alterar |
Contexto | Real | |
Modal | Sim | |
Help | Código do ato processual |
Campo | O0O_DESATO | |
Tipo | C - Caracter | |
Tamanho | 200 | |
Decimal | 0 | |
Formato | @S100 | |
Título | Ato Process | |
Descrição | Descrição Ato Processual | |
Nível | 1 | |
Usado | Sim | |
Obrigatório | Não | |
Browse | Sim | Validação |
Inicializador Padrão | IF(!INCLUI,POSICIONE('NRO',1,XFILIAL('NRO')+O0O->O0O_CODATO,'NRO_DESC'), JURGATILHO('O0O_CODATO','NRO','NRO_DESC','O0OMASTER')) | |
Visual | Visualizar | |
Contexto | Real | |
Modal | Sim | |
Help | Descrição Ato Processual |
- Tabela O0P - Palavras Chave Ato Processual
Campo | O0P_FILIAL | |
Tipo | C | |
Tamanho | 8 | |
Decimal | 0 | |
Formato | @! | |
Título | Filial | |
Descrição | Filial do Sistema | |
Usado | Não | |
Obrigatório | Não | |
Browse | Não | Relação |
Val. Sistema | Help | Filial do Sistema |
Campo | O0J_CATOAU | ||
Tipo | C - Caracter | ||
Tamanho | 5 | ||
Decimal | 0 | Formato||
Título | Cod Ato Proc | ||
Descrição | Código do Ato Processual | ||
Nível | 1 | ||
Usado | Sim | ||
Obrigatório | Sim | ||
Browse | Não | Validação | Inicializador Padrão|
Visual | Alterar | ||
Contexto | Real | ||
Modal | Sim | ||
Help | Código Ato Proc Autom |
Campo | O0P_COD |
Tipo | C - Caracter |
Tamanho | 5 |
Decimal | 0 |
Formato | @! |
Título | Cod Pal Chav |
Descrição | Código da Palavra Chave |
Nível | 1 |
Usado | Sim |
Obrigatório | Sim |
Browse | Não |
Validação | ExistChav('O0P',M->O0P_COD,1) |
Inicializador Padrão | GETSXENUM("O0P","O0P_COD") |
Visual | Visualizar |
Contexto | Real |
Modal | Sim |
Help | Código da Palavra Chave |
Campo | O0P_CPCHAV | |
Tipo | C - Caracter | |
Tamanho | 200 | |
Decimal | 0 | Formato|
Título | Palavra Chav | |
Descrição | Palavra Chave | |
Nível | 1 | |
Usado | Sim | |
Obrigatório | Sim | |
Browse | Não | Validação |
Inicializador Padrão | Visual | Alterar |
Contexto | Real | |
Modal | Não | |
Help | Código do assunto |
3. Criação ou Alteração de Índices no arquivo SIX – Índices:
Índice | O0O |
Ordem | 1 |
Chave | O0O_FILIAL+O0O_COD |
Descrição | Código |
Proprietário | S |
Índice | O0P |
Ordem | 1 |
Chave | O0P_FILIAL+O0P_CATOAU+O0P_COD |
Descrição | Cód Ato Automático + Código |
Proprietário | S |
4. Criação de Gatilhos no arquivo SX7 – Gatilhos:
- Tabela O0O– Ato Processual Automático
Campo | O0O_CODATO | |
Sequência | 001 | |
Campo domínio | O0O_DESATO | |
Tipo | P | |
Regra | NRO-> NRO_DESC | |
Posiciona? | S | |
Chave | xFilial('NRO')+M->O0O_CODATO | |
Condição | Proprietário | S |
Procedimento para Utilização
Exemplo:
- Cadastro de Ato Processual
- No modulo Gestão Jurídica (SIGAJURI), acesse Atualizações / Jurídico / Andamentos / Atos Processuais.
- Clique na opção Incluir;
- Preencha os dados necessários para o Ato e clique em Confirmar para finalizar a operação;
- Clique em Fechar na mensagem de Registro inserido.
- Cadastro do Ato Processual Automático
No modulo Gestão Jurídica (SIGAJURI), acesse Ainda no modulo acesse Atualizações / Assuntos Jurídicos / Importação de Publicação.;
Informar Informe os parâmetros de acordo com o cenário cenário;
- Executar Execute;
- No Menu menu Outras Ações, selecione Ato Processual Automático;
- Clique em Incluir
- Informe o Ato Processual e a Palavra chave que deseja para o filtro;
- ConfirmarConfirme;